Web31 jul. 2024 · The only way to confirm whether a disc has bulged or herniated is through magnetic resonance imaging-an MRI. Nonetheless, even if a herniated disc is confirmed via MRI, it may not be the cause of your pain. Many people show MRI evidence of bulging and herniated discs but do not feel pain or discomfort.

WebDuring a microdiscectomy surgery, the surgeon utilizes a small incision (1-1.5 inches) at the back to access the diseased intervertebral disc. The surgeon uses a magnifying operating microscope to better visualize the disc.
